Safe Shore is a Psychedelic Harm Reduction, Education and Peer Support project.
Safe Shore is Harm Reduction, Education and Peer Support project operating safe spaces at parties and festivals and offering guidance and support for event participants who are dealing with challenging psychedelic experiences. In addition to our field work, we offer experiential workshops, in which we trained more than 600 psychedelic harm reduction sitters around the world.
